Message type: E = Error
Message class: /SAPAPO/MSDP_LOG -
Message number: 001
Message text: BAL object/subobject for SNP application cannot be determined

- BAL object/subobject for SNP application cannot be determined ?The SAP error message
/SAPAPO/MSDP_LOG001
indicates that the system is unable to determine the appropriate Business Application Log (BAL) object or subobject for the Supply Network Planning (SNP) application. This error can occur in various scenarios, such as during planning runs, data uploads, or when executing specific transactions related to SNP.Causes:
- Configuration Issues: The BAL object or subobject may not be properly configured in the system. This could be due to missing entries in the configuration tables.
- Missing Authorizations: The user executing the transaction may not have the necessary authorizations to access the BAL object or subobject.
- System Bugs: There may be bugs or inconsistencies in the SAP system that lead to this error.
- Incorrect Customization: If there have been recent changes or customizations in the SNP area, they might have inadvertently affected the BAL configuration.
- Transport Issues: If the system has recently undergone a transport of changes, it may not have been properly imported or activated.
Solutions:
Check Configuration:
- Verify the configuration of the Business Application Log in the SAP system. You can check the relevant tables (e.g.,
BALDAT
,BALOBJ
, etc.) to ensure that the necessary entries exist for the SNP application.- Use transaction
SLG1
to view the logs and identify any specific issues related to the BAL configuration.Review Authorizations:
-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the SNP application and the associated BAL objects. You can check this using transaction
SU53
after the error occurs.Check for Notes and Patches:
- Look for any SAP Notes or patches that address this specific error. SAP frequently releases updates that fix known issues.
Debugging:
- If you have access to debugging tools, you can analyze the code to see where the error is being triggered. This may provide insights into what is causing the system to fail in determining the BAL object/subobject.
Consult SAP Support:
- If the issue persists after checking the above points, consider reaching out to SAP Support for assistance. Provide them with detailed information about the error, including transaction codes, user roles, and any recent changes made to the system.
Related Information:
SLG1
: Display Application LogSLG2
: Display Application Log for ObjectSNP1
: SNP Planning BookBy following these steps, you should be able to identify the cause of the error and implement a solution.
